  22. that happened here too after all that muddy water flooded the lake , they dropped it like 4 feet exposeing what little wood we have here so fishing shallow was a lot tougher..what i did was work my jig mostly around rock. I figured if they cant find wood then they'll go for rock instead and thats where i got my bites
